[dpdk-stable] [dpdk-dev] [PATCH V2] net/bonding: fix lacp negotiation failed

Ferruh Yigit ferruh.yigit at intel.com
Sat Jul 11 05:07:16 CEST 2020


On 7/11/2020 2:20 AM, Wei Hu (Xavier) wrote:

> 
> On 2020/7/10 11:29, luyicai wrote:
>> From: Yicai Lu <luyicai at huawei.com>
>>
>> When two host is connected directly without any devices like switch,
>> rx_machine_update would recieving partner lacp negotiation packets,
>> and partner's port mac is filled with zeros in this packet,
>> which is different with internal's mode4 mac. So in this situation,
>> it would never go rx_machine branch and then execute mac swap for negotiation!
>> Thus bond mode 4 will negotiation failed.
>>
>> Fixes: 56cbc0817399 ("net/bonding: fix LACP negotiation")
>> Cc: stable at dpdk.org
>>
>> Signed-off-by: luyicai <luyicai at huawei.com>
>
> Reviewed-by: Wei Hu (Xavier) <xavier.huwei at huawei.com>
> 
Applied to dpdk-next-net/master, thanks.


More information about the stable mailing list